Handyman services involve a wide range of repair, maintenance, and improvement tasks around the home or property. These professionals are equipped to handle various small to medium-sized projects, including fixing leaky faucets, repairing drywall, installing shelves, or replacing door hardware. Their expertise helps address everyday issues that can arise unexpectedly or as part of routine upkeep, ensuring that properties remain functional and well-maintained without the need for multiple specialized contractors.
Many common problems can be efficiently resolved by handyman services, saving homeowners time and effort. For example, if a door won’t close properly, a faucet is dripping, or a cabinet door is loose, local service providers can often fix these issues quickly. They also assist with more involved projects like patching and painting walls, assembling furniture, or installing fixtures. These services are ideal for addressing tasks that require a combination of practical skills, problem-solving, and attention to detail, helping to prevent small issues from escalating into larger, costlier repairs.

The overview below groups typical Handyman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or fixes like fixing leaky faucets or patching drywall range from $50 to $300.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ects pushing below or above these amounts.
Medium Projects - larger tasks such as installing new cabinets or replacing flooring usually cost between $500 and $2,500. These projects are common and represent a broad spectrum of typical handyman services.
Major Renovations - extensive work like bathroom remodels or basement finishing can range from $3,000 to $10,000 or more. While less frequent, these larger projects often involve detailed planning and higher costs.
Full Replacement - complete replacements, such as new roofing or HVAC units, generally start around $5,000 and can exceed $20,000. These are less common but represent the upper end of the service providers' typical scope of work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ing local contractors for handyman services,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a track record of successfully completing tasks comparable to the work needed. This can help ensure that the contractor understands the scope and nuances of the job, reducing the likelihood of surprises or subpar results. Asking about past projects or reviewing portfolios can provide insight into their familiarity with the specific type of work, whether it involves repairs, installations, or general maintenance.
Clear written expectations are essential when evaluating potential service providers. Homeowners should seek out contractors who can provide detailed descriptions of the scope of work, materials to be used, and any other relevant details in writing. This helps establish a shared understanding of what the project entails, minimizing misunderstandings or miscommunications down the line. A well-defined plan also serves as a useful reference point throughout the project, ensuring that everyone is aligned on deliverables and responsibilities.
Reputable references and good communication are key indicators of a trustworthy service provider. Homeowners are encouraged to ask for references or reviews from previous clients to gauge the contractor’s reliability and quality of work. Additionally, responsive and clear communication during the initial contact can reflect how the contractor will handle ongoing updates or questions.
